The image shows two spherical objects with a metallic and rust-like texture, each on a tripod base. The object on the left has a circular emblem or lock labeled "THE GLOBE." The color palette includes shades of dark brown, black, and hints of metallic tones. The spheres are positioned on the left and right sides of the image, with the left sphere rotated to display the emblem, while the right sphere is viewed straight-on.
